What is Cloud Mining?

Cloud mining simplifies the process of earning cryptocurrency by allowing users to rent hash power online, eliminating the need for expensive hardware and the associated costs of electricity and maintenance. This model provides a straightforward way for individuals to receive daily rewards in popular c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in, Litecoin, Kaspa, and Dogecoin.
